    Abstract: In the multi-layer coil component, the hole portion is provided in the vicinity of the side surface of the element body, and the distance from the tip position of the external electrode to the hole portion is shorter than the distance from the tip position of the external electrode to the coil. Therefore, when a crack is generated starting from the tip position of the external electrode on the mounting surface, the crack progress toward the hole portion located at a distance closer than the coil. Therefore, in the multi-layer coil component, splitting of the coil due to the crack can be prevented.

    Abstract: A motion detection section 30 detects the posture of an HMD worn on the head of a user. A status determination section 32 determines a user's gaze direction and a binocular inclination angle in accordance with the detected posture of the HMD. The binocular inclination angle is the angle between a horizontal plane and a line connecting the left and right eyes of the user. An image identification section 34 determines two images for use in the generation of left- and right-eye parallax images from a plurality of viewpoint images stored in an image storage device 16 in accordance with the user's gaze direction and the binocular inclination angle. An image generation section 36 generates left- and right-eye parallax images from the two identified images. An image supply section 38 supplies the generated parallax images to the HMD.

    Abstract: Magnetic members of a high-sensitivity magnetoimpedance element and a low-sensitivity magnetoimpedance element are connected to each other in series, and the strength and direction of an external magnetic field is detected on the basis of an impedance variation of this series circuit. The output of a magnetic field detection sensor mainly reflects an impedance variation of the high-sensitivity magnetoimpedance element in a weak magnetic field range, and mainly reflects an impedance variation of the low-sensitivity magnetoimpedance element in a strong magnetic field range, whereby continuous detection is enabled in a wide range from a weak magnetic field to a strong magnetic field.
